How to fill out child protection policy draft:

01
Start by gathering information about your organization's current child protection policies and any relevant legal requirements. This may include reviewing existing policies, consulting with legal advisors, and researching applicable laws and regulations.
02
Identify the key components that should be included in your policy draft. This may include sections on defining child protection, outlining responsibilities and roles, outlining procedures for reporting and responding to child protection concerns, and outlining procedures for recruitment and training of staff and volunteers.
03
Begin drafting each section of the policy, ensuring that they are clear, concise, and aligned with your organization's values and mission. Consider using language that is easily understandable and accessible to all stakeholders.
04
Seek input and feedback from relevant stakeholders, including staff, volunteers, parents, and legal advisors. This can help to ensure that the policy is comprehensive and addresses the specific needs and concerns of your organization.
05
Revise and refine the draft based on the feedback received. Take into consideration any legal requirements or recommendations provided by legal advisors.
06
Once finalized, distribute the policy draft to all relevant parties for review, and provide them with an opportunity to ask questions or provide further input.
07
If necessary, make any necessary revisions based on the feedback received during the review process.
08
Obtain approvals from relevant authorities, such as the board of directors or senior management, before finalizing and implementing the policy.
09
Communicate the finalized child protection policy to all relevant stakeholders, ensuring that they understand their roles and responsibilities in implementing and adhering to the policy.
10
Regularly review and update the child protection policy to ensure it remains relevant and aligned with any changes in laws, regulations, or organizational practices.

Who needs child protection policy draft:

01
Nonprofit organizations and charities working with children.
02
Schools, educational institutions, and childcare providers.
03
Youth and sports organizations.
04
Government agencies and departments responsible for child welfare.
05
Volunteer organizations and community groups that interact with children.
06
Religious organizations that offer services or programs involving children.
07
Healthcare providers and hospitals working with children.
08
Foster care and adoption agencies.
09
Camps, recreational programs, and afterschool programs for children.
10
Childcare centers, daycare facilities, and home-based caregivers.
